1. 首先,确认 Syslog 用户是否已经存在。可以使用以下命令来检查:
cat /etc/passwd | grep syslog

如果输出结果中包含 Syslog 用户,则说明该用户已经存在。

  1. 然后,使用以下命令来修改文件的权限,使得 Syslog 用户可以读取:
sudo chmod +r '/home/weipeiru/adguard_conf/work/data/querylog.json'

这将给予该文件读取权限。

  1. 最后,将 Syslog 用户添加到文件所在目录的组中,以便该用户可以访问该目录下的所有文件。假设该目录的组名为 'log',则可以使用以下命令:
sudo usermod -aG log syslog

这将把 Syslog 用户添加到 'log' 组中。

现在,Syslog 用户应该可以读取 '/home/weipeiru/adguard_conf/work/data/querylog.json' 文件了。

如何为 Syslog 用户赋予读取 /home/weipeiru/adguard_conf/work/data/querylog.json 文件的权限

原文地址: http://www.cveoy.top/t/topic/jS9c 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录